Porcelain bathroom tiles: the complete guide to choosing

At the start of the search, bathroom tiles seem to offer endless possibilities. The opposite is true: no other room in the house is so tightly constrained. Permanent humidity, water sitting on the floor for minutes at a time, harsh cleaning products used frequently, surfaces walked on barefoot. The bathroom sets conditions before it offers choices, and knowing them narrows the field far faster than any aesthetic criterion.

One clarification before going further. Floor and wall are not subject to the same constraints: the floor has to meet precise technical requirements, the wall covering almost none. What the bathroom demands of a surface

Before starting to choose, it helps to know what you are looking for. Four stresses act on this room, and each one translates into a requirement you can verify on a technical datasheet.

The first is permanent humidity. This is not about shower water, but about the steam that saturates the air after every use and settles everywhere, including on walls far from the wet area. A porous surface absorbs it, and that absorption is the starting point for deep staining, persistent hazing and mould in the grout lines. The figure that measures it is water absorption, expressed as a percentage of weight: porcelain stoneware stays below 0.5%, a threshold that makes it near-waterproof — enough to behave as such in domestic use, for the whole life of the bathroom.

The second is chemical attack. The bathroom is where the harshest products in the house end up: acidic limescale removers, chlorine-based disinfectants, tap cleaners that inevitably run down onto the surface below. A material that cannot cope does not crack — it does something more insidious: it gradually loses its evenness, and the damage is irreversible because it happens in the layer you actually see.

The third is barefoot traffic on a wet surface, the typical bathroom condition and one that occurs in no other domestic room with the same frequency. It shapes the choice of floor tiles more than anything else, and it deserves the section that follows.

The fourth is cleaning frequency. No room is cleaned as often as the bathroom, and usually in a hurry. A surface that calls for special attention, periodic treatments or dedicated products is not a technical detail: it is a daily burden.

Porcelain answers all four at once, which is why it has become the de facto standard for this room: not because it is always the best-looking option, but because it is the only material that asks for no compromise on any of the four fronts. Anti-slip bathroom tiles: which rating is needed

For the floor of a domestic bathroom, the practical benchmark is R10. It covers the real situation — spread humidity, splashes, water sitting for a few minutes — without the pronounced texture of more heavily slip-resistant surfaces, which is noticeable underfoot in a room walked on barefoot and lengthens cleaning.

There is a second value to read, however, and in this room it counts just as much. The R scale comes from a test carried out wearing shoes, whereas here you walk barefoot on a wet surface: for that condition a separate classification exists, expressed with the letters A, B and C. In the shower area, the only spot where you stand still on a wet surface, class B is the commonly accepted benchmark. Finish and colour: what you see every day

Technical requirements tell you whether a tile will hold up. The finish tells you what living with that bathroom will be like day to day, and it is the part almost nobody assesses when choosing, because it does not show on a dry sample under screen light.

In a room where water evaporates continuously, the daily adversary is limescale. It settles as pale, dull hazing, the cleaner removes it and it comes back: this is not a problem you solve once, it is a permanent condition you live with. Matt and natural surfaces mask it far better, because they lack the even reflection that makes every deposit visible in raking light. In a bathroom, a matt finish is therefore not only a contemporary aesthetic choice: it is what narrows the gap between the freshly cleaned room and the same room three days later.

A second, more technical figure is abrasion resistance, measured by the PEI rating. In a bathroom it is not a tight constraint: the room is small, walked on barefoot or in slippers, without the abrasive grit carried in from outside in an entrance hall. PEI 3 is more than adequate, and insisting on higher values means applying to this room a criterion designed for circulation areas.

Colour works on the same ground, in a less obvious way than people assume. Very dark, saturated shades show limescale clearly, because the deposit is pale and the contrast highlights it; very light shades show organic soiling better. Mid tones, and surfaces with slight shade variation within them, are the most forgiving: neither type of residue finds an even background to stand out against. Then there is light, often artificial and directional in this room: the same tile changes character under cool or warm lighting, and deserves to be judged in the conditions in which it will actually be seen. Tile sizes: start from the real dimensions of the room

Where size is concerned, the discussion almost always centres on visual effect. But in a bathroom there is a constraint that comes first, and no product datasheet can tell you about it: this is the room with the highest density of obstacles per square metre in the whole house. Floor-standing or wall-hung sanitaryware, shower tray, soil pipes, inspection hatches, niches, fitted units, thresholds. Every obstacle is a cut, and every cut is where the chosen size proves either well judged or awkward.

The working rule is simple: a larger tile reduces the number of grout lines but raises the cost of every single mistake. In a bathroom of a few square metres, a 120x120 cm tile cut wrongly cannot be used up elsewhere, because there is nowhere free. The ratio between whole and cut tiles can shift to the point where the advantage of large format tiles is lost during installation. The sizes that work best in this room are the intermediate ones — 60x60, 60x120 — which give continuous surfaces while staying manageable around obstacles.

Then comes a choice that affects the result more than its technical name suggests. A rectified tile has edges mechanically trimmed to exactly 90 degrees after firing, with a dimensional precision that allows 2 mm grout lines. In a bathroom the consequence is twofold: less grout surface means fewer places where limescale and soap residue collect, and visually the eye stops reading a grid and reads a surface instead. In a small room, where every wall is half a metre from your gaze, that difference registers every day.

One last check if there is underfloor heating below, a common arrangement in this room in particular: porcelain is among the coverings that transmit heat best, and there is no contraindication. Thickness does matter, though, because a thinner tile reduces thermal inertia and shortens the time the system takes to reach temperature.

The zones of the room ask for different things

So far the reasoning has been about the room as a whole. But a bathroom is not one single surface: four zones coexist within a few square metres, with distinct requirements, and each develops a different recurring problem that the choice of surface can either ease or aggravate.

Zone Water exposure Leading requirement Most frequent problem Finish
Floor Recurrent, water standing for a few minutes R10 grip and ease of cleaning Dull hazing left by cleaners and residue Matt or natural
Shower area Continuous and direct, with cleaning products Barefoot classification class B Mould in grout lines and silicone Textured but easy to clean
Basin wall and splash zone Frequent but superficial Ease of cleaning, resistance to products Limescale and soap splashes Smooth, lightly textured
Dry walls Steam only No binding requirement Condensation in poorly ventilated corners Open, aesthetics decide

The shower area deserves a note, because it is the only zone where the choice of tile depends on a decision taken earlier: whether the floor will be tiled or resolved with a shower tray. In the first case the surface continues without a break, a finish with the grip described above is needed, and the tile has to be able to follow the fall towards the drain, which generally rules out the largest sizes. In the second, tiling stops at the walls, the floor is a separate element with its own properties, and no constraint applies to size at all.

One misunderstanding worth clearing up, because it is the most expensive one: the watertightness of a shower does not come from the tile, it comes from the waterproofing membrane laid underneath. Porcelain is near-waterproof, but it is the build-up below that stops water getting through. No choice of tile compensates for poorly executed waterproofing.

Effects: what really changes, and what does not

A useful clarification before choosing the look: the effect does not change technical behaviour. The body is the same, absorption is the same, grip depends on the finish and not on the pattern. A wood-effect tile and a marble-effect tile with the same finish behave identically in this room. Choosing the effect is therefore genuinely free, once the requirements described above are met.

Why the choice weighs on cost more here than elsewhere

Something you only discover when doing the sums: the bathroom is the room in the house with the highest ratio of tiled wall surface to floor surface. In a living room you tile the floor and nothing else. In a bathroom you tile the floor and three or four walls, and the vertical square metres often exceed the horizontal ones by two or three times.

The consequence is that every unit decision gets multiplied by a far larger area than you have in mind. A price difference between two products that looks negligible at a glance becomes significant across the total. And the reverse holds too: giving up a useful property to keep the unit price down produces a proportionally larger saving, but across a surface you will have in front of you every day, half a metre from your eyes.

Two factors weigh more than the rest. The first is size, which affects installation cost: larger tiles demand more care per piece but cover ground faster, and the balance shifts depending on how regular the room is. The second is wastage, the material lost in cutting: in a bathroom, because of the density of obstacles already discussed, the percentage to allow for when ordering is higher than in an unobstructed room, and large sizes push it higher still. These are assessments to make before choosing the size, not after.

How to proceed, in practice

The order of decisions matters more than the decisions themselves. Start with the floor and the shower, because they are the only surfaces with non-negotiable constraints: grip suited to barefoot use, a finish that stands up to limescale, a size compatible with the real obstacles in the room. Once that perimeter is settled, the walls are free — no technical requirement conditions them — and every choice becomes a matter of taste again. This is the opposite of the usual approach, first what appeals and then a check that it works, and it is why so many bathrooms turn out to be impractical only once the work is finished.

Frequently asked questions

Are porcelain bathroom tiles really waterproof?

Water absorption is below 0.5%, so it is fair to describe them as near-waterproof. Be careful not to confuse the material with the system, though: the watertightness of a shower area depends on the membrane laid beneath the tiles, not on the tiles themselves.

Do bathroom tiles have to be rectified?

No, there is no technical obligation. Rectified tiles allow narrower grout lines and therefore less residue build-up, but they need a perfectly level substrate to show at their best.

Can porcelain be used on walls as well?

Yes, and it is now the most common solution in contemporary bathrooms. The only point to check is weight: with large sizes and greater thicknesses, an adhesive suited to vertical installation and a substrate able to carry the load are both needed.

How many extra tiles should be ordered?

More than the theoretical calculation, because cuts around sanitaryware and drains generate wastage, and the allowance to plan for is higher here than in a regular room. It is best to order everything at once and from the same batch: different production batches of the same product can show slight shade variations that are hard to correct later.

Can porcelain be laid over existing bathroom tiles?

It is possible if the existing substrate is soundly bonded, level and free of loose areas, using an adhesive suited to tiling over tiles. The rise in floor level does need to be taken into account, though, as in a bathroom it interferes with thresholds, doors, floor-standing sanitaryware and drains.

Can the bathroom floor be the same as the rest of the house?

Yes, provided the product chosen offers grip suited to use in a damp room. Continuous flooring between the bathroom and the sleeping area is an increasingly common choice, and it is the bathroom that sets the technical constraint: it is the most demanding room, so it is the starting point.

Should bathroom grout be a particular colour?

From a maintenance point of view, the type of grout matters more than the colour: in areas in direct contact with water, epoxy grout resists staining and mould better than cement-based grout. The choice of colour, by contrast, answers to aesthetic criteria and to how the surfaces are matched.
